Sage Dental Management is a leading, rapidly growing Dental Service Organization (DSO) committed to innovation, excellence, and patient-centered care. The Executive Assistant will provide high-level administrative support to multiple members of the leadership team, ensuring efficient operations and effective communication across the enterprise. This role requires exceptional organizational skills, professionalism, discretion, and the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
· Executive Calendar Management, as assigned or requested: Manage and prioritize complex calendars, schedule meetings and appointments, and proactively resolve conflicts and optimize executive time using sound judgement with minimal supervision.
· Communication Hub: Act as the primary point of contact and liaison between assigned executives and internal/external stakeholders. Screen calls, emails, and correspondence, ensuring prompt responses and routing of inquiries.
· Travel and Logistics Coordination: Arrange comprehensive travel itineraries for executives and multiple departments, as assigned (flights, accommodations, transportation). Manage the expense reporting process for assigned executive(s) and their teams, as needed.
· Meeting Support: Organize and coordinate meetings, conferences, and company events, including logistics, preparing materials, taking minutes, and tracking action items.
· Project Assistance: Support special projects, conduct research, and assist with data analysis as needed.
· Confidentiality: Handle sensitive information and confidential matters with the highest levels of discretion and integrity.
· May be asked to do regular or ad hoc reporting from internal systems.
· Assist with setting up orientation and onboarding of new executives and team members.
· Other duties as assigned from time to time.
Bachelor’s degree in business administration or equivalent experience.
· 7+ years of experience supporting one or more senior executives, preferably in the healthcare industry.
·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ook) and experience with calendar and project management.
· Exceptional ability to manage multiple priorities, work under pressure, meet tight deadlines, and maintain meticulous attention to detail.
· Excellent written and verbal communication skills for effective interaction with all levels of staff and external stakeholders in the English language.
· Strong problem-solving skills, proactive nature, adaptability, sound judgement, emotional intelligence, and the ability to work both independently and collaboratively.
· Excellent customer service skills.
